研究领域 |
心血管疾病相关的免疫调控机制
工作经历 |
2005年-至今 南京大学、南京医科大学、南京中医药大学教授;南京大学、南京医科大学、南京中医药大学博士生导师
2002年-至今 南京大学附属鼓楼医院心脏科行政主任
